Managing Anxiety: Learn to Breathe Again
Anxiety can be overwhelming, but with the right strategies, it can be managed effectively. Treatment often includes cognitive-behavioral therapy, mindfulness practices, and sometimes medication. Learning to manage anxiety involves understanding the triggers, recognizing early signs of anxiety, and employing techniques to calm the mind and body, helping individuals to ‘breathe again’ and enjoy a more relaxed and focused life.

Sleep Disorder Treatment: Sleep Hygiene Techniques
Sleep disorders can significantly impact one’s quality of life, but with proper treatment, individuals can improve their sleep patterns. Sleep hygiene techniques, such as establishing a regular sleep schedule, creating a conducive sleeping environment, and limiting exposure to screens before bedtime, are often recommended. These practices, combined with professional advice, can lead to better sleep and improved overall health.

OCD Support: Healing OCD in Stages
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) is a complex mental health condition that benefits from staged interventions. Starting with cognitive-behavioral therapy, treatment often involves exposure and response prevention techniques, which help reduce the compulsive behaviors and obsessive thoughts characteristic of OCD. Over time, these interventions can significantly alleviate the symptoms, leading to improved functionality and quality of life.

What should I expect during my first visit to a psychiatrist in Bowman Island?
During your first visit, the psychiatrist will typically conduct a comprehensive assessment which may include discussing your medical history, current symptoms, and any medications you are taking. The session might also involve a discussion about your mental health and lifestyle. This initial consultation helps the psychiatrist formulate a treatment plan tailored to your needs.
